pub struct DirectoryUserPosixAccount {
pub accountId: Option<String>,
pub gecos: Option<String>,
pub gid: Option<String>,
pub homeDirectory: Option<String>,
pub operatingSystemType: Option<String>,
pub primary: Option<bool>,
pub shell: Option<String>,
pub systemId: Option<String>,
pub uid: Option<String>,
pub username: Option<String>,
}Fields§
§accountId: Option<String>§gecos: Option<String>§gid: Option<String>§homeDirectory: Option<String>§operatingSystemType: Option<String>§primary: Option<bool>§shell: Option<String>§systemId: Option<String>§uid: Option<String>§username: Option<String>Trait Implementations§
Source§impl Debug for DirectoryUserPosixAccount
impl Debug for DirectoryUserPosixAccount
Source§impl<'de> Deserialize<'de> for DirectoryUserPosixAccount
impl<'de> Deserialize<'de> for DirectoryUserPosixAccount
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for DirectoryUserPosixAccount
impl RefUnwindSafe for DirectoryUserPosixAccount
impl Send for DirectoryUserPosixAccount
impl Sync for DirectoryUserPosixAccount
impl Unpin for DirectoryUserPosixAccount
impl UnwindSafe for DirectoryUserPosixAccount
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more